federal and state governments offer pensions to certain military veterans and their families. pension application papers can be a valuable source of genealogical information. they can include marriage certificates, birth records, etc. governments should maintain a pension file for each applicant.

many of our ancestors served in the military. it would be great to obtain copies of their complete pension files, if possible.

federal pension files from 1775 to 1915 are available at the national archives building in washington d.c. if anyone visits washington d.c., it would be great to visit the national archives building and make copies of the complete pension files for some of our ancestors.

alternatively, a copy of a complete pension application file (up to 100 pages) can be ordered online for a fee (currently $80), using form NATF 85D.

here is information for one ancestor:

jeremiah ervin served in the civil war. his wife/widow was rebecca ann opliger ervin. it seems that at least two pension applications were filed on behalf of jeremiah:

pension application filed 18 Feb 1888, application no. 640412, certificate no. 441692, state filed: indiana

pension application filed 28 Jun 1890, application no. 426577, certificate no. 470089, state filed: indiana

the second application (no. 426577) may contain the most information. tom ervin uploaded portions of this pension file at ancestry.com, and it includes a marriage certificate for jeremiah and rebecca as well as information regarding some of their children and other interesting documents.
